Php 当用户从浏览器中禁用cookie并且不允许开发人员使用会话时,我应该在哪里存储用户数据

Php 当用户从浏览器中禁用cookie并且不允许开发人员使用会话时,我应该在哪里存储用户数据,php,session,cookies,Php,Session,Cookies,当用户从浏览器中禁用Cookie并且不允许开发人员使用会话时,我应该在哪里存储用户数据 这个问题是在我参加PHP开发人员工作面试时提出的,请帮助我。您可以提供浏览器令牌,这意味着用户在与网站交互时需要向url添加特定令牌,如?toke=xyz。 (您还可以将其添加到每个链接和表单的代码中) 然后,您只需在数据库中检查该令牌,并查看该用户是否拥有有效的会话。(如果超过x天,则应删除令牌)您也可以使用客户端浏览器数据库

当用户从浏览器中禁用Cookie并且不允许开发人员使用会话时,我应该在哪里存储用户数据


这个问题是在我参加PHP开发人员工作面试时提出的,请帮助我。

您可以提供浏览器令牌,这意味着用户在与网站交互时需要向url添加特定令牌,如?toke=xyz。 (您还可以将其添加到每个链接和表单的代码中)


然后,您只需在数据库中检查该令牌,并查看该用户是否拥有有效的会话。(如果超过x天,则应删除令牌)

您也可以使用客户端浏览器数据库